    9 W415-0330 / B / 03.25.04 This fireplace requires a 15 amp, 120 volt and 60 hz circuit that is grounded to the electrical socket. The fire- place should be on its own circuit. If there are other appliances on the same circuit, this may cause the cir- cuit breaker or fuse to blow when the fireplace heater is in operation. The unit comes with a 6&ap[...]
